diff --git a/src/display/svg.js b/src/display/svg.js index f67a847e8..c772a5eb3 100644 --- a/src/display/svg.js +++ b/src/display/svg.js @@ -692,7 +692,8 @@ SVGGraphics = (function SVGGraphicsClosure() { var width = glyph.width; var character = glyph.fontChar; - var charWidth = width * widthAdvanceScale + charSpacing * fontDirection; + var spacing = (glyph.isSpace ? wordSpacing : 0) + charSpacing; + var charWidth = width * widthAdvanceScale + spacing * fontDirection; x += charWidth; current.tspan.textContent += character;